Web7 nov. 2024 · Roast the turkey in the preheated oven uncovered for 15 minutes per pound, or about 3 hours for a 12 pound turkey. A th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the thigh should read 165ºF-170ºF. Remove the turkey from the oven and allow it to rest 15-20 minutes before carving. Web9 dec. 2024 · Put the frozen turkey (don't remove the packaging) in a bowl and cover with water. Let all parts of the packaging be submerged in the water. Change the water every 20 - 25 minutes till the turkey is thawed. Web28 mrt. 2024 · Roast the turkey (2 to 3 hours). The timing will vary depending on its size. See How Long to Cook a Turkey for details. Plan on between 2 and 2 ½ hours total for a 14- to 16-pound bird. Start at a high temperature (450 degrees F for 45 minutes), then reduce to 325 degrees F. Let the turkey rest (30 minutes).
